Marek Perczak

Impressive monument, playground for children and fruit market for tourist. Monument as sculpture is huge and worth seeing. Sadly, there is no information in English. Moreover information stone is dirty. Playground for children is small, yet is free. Fruit market is well over priced. Coconut juice coated 50 bat, when outside the turistic zone, it costs 30. Memorial park is a small open space with green grass and walking alleys near sea side.
